Seers: Govt planning, efficient handling of crisis saved the day
Prayagraj: Strategic preparations of state govt and promptness of mela officials helped avert a potential tragedy at the ongoing Maha Kumbh on the occasion of the Mauni Amavasya amrit snan, on Wednesday. Groups of seers, sadhus and devotees, who arrived at the mela area on Wednesday, claimed state govt had made elaborate arrangements for Maha Kumbh, but the manner in which the crowd increased on Wednesday, a tragedy could have taken place. Thanks to alertness and promptness of state govt, mela administration and police, the impact was minimised, was the refrain.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ath has been monitoring the mela throughout and receiving minute-to-minute reports. As soon as he received information of a stampede in the morning, Yogi gathered updates from officials concerned and called a high-level meeting with chief secretary, principal secretary (home), DGP and ADG (law and order) at his official residence early morning and issued necessary instructions.Meanwhile, Mahamandaleshwar Swami Prakashanand of Shri Panch Dashnam Awahan Akhara said state govt and mela police took immediate action, which saved many lives. The kind of crowd there was, this could have been a much bigger accident, he said, adding, it was arrangements of state govt and quick response of mela police that contained the impact. "Kudos to Yogi govt for this security," he said. President of Narayan Seva Sansthan, Prashant Agarwal, said crores of devotees from all over the country and world gathered for the Mauni Amavasya Amrit Snan. Govt and administration showed promptness and controlled the incident to a major extent. Due to hard work of govt and officials engaged in the system, Amrit Snan of Maha Kumbh was completed with peaceful arrangements. "I appeal to devotees and saints who have come for Amrit Snan to be cautious and not pay attention to rumours. I appreciate efforts of administration and expect cooperation from everyone," said Agarwal.According to an eyewitness, despite Yogi-led state govt's fool-proof plan for Mauni Amavasya, overcrowding was responsible for the incident that occurred between 1 am and 2 am, adding that if there was no pushing and shoving, the incident could have been averted. Gopalganj, Bihar resident Kumkum Srivastava said it was Maha Kumbh was a very good experience as Yogi govt made good arrangements, while the incident happened due negligence of some people. When the govt was repeatedly appealing that everyone should bathe wherever they had reached, there was no need to go to Sangam Nose," she said.
